The Importance of Post-Cycle Therapy
Before diving into the specifics of PCT after using drostanolone pillole, it is important to understand why it is necessary. Anabolic steroids, including drostanolone pillole, suppress the body’s natural production of testosterone. This can lead to a number of negative side effects, such as decreased libido, mood swings, and even infertility. PCT helps to restore the body’s natural testosterone production and prevent these side effects from occurring.
Additionally, PCT can also help to maintain the gains made during a cycle of drostanolone pillole. Without proper PCT, the body can experience a significant drop in muscle mass and strength, known as post-cycle crash. This can be avoided by implementing an effective PCT protocol.
